Letter to the Editor

Isn’t it interesting that state House Speaker Jim Black can, at his leisure, suddenly appoint six more members to the Finance Committee so as to ensure the tax plan he favors gets cleared through this committee (news story, June 15). I guess it’s just politics as usual in North Carolina. Why are statewide elections even held, when one or two politicians (Black and Senate President Pro Tem Marc Basnight) seemingly control all that is, or is not, passed in the legislature?

Charles Closson

Raleigh
